Today we are highlighting Indica, a recent book by Pranay Lal on the natural history of the Indian subcontinent. Reading through the intricate detail in which he describes events that happened long ago, one might feel like it is a work of fiction. But decades of research and a gift for writing fantastically help Pranay tell stories of an India that is lost to oral history. Make sure you have a map of India handy, as he goes into great detail about where you can find the places he talks about. Wildfire is a 2023 fiction and contemporary romance novel by Hannah Vivian-Byrne, known professionally as Hannah Grace (born 4 June 1993) is a Welsh singer-songwriter from Bridgend in South Wales and author Hannah Grace and the second book in her Maple Hills series, following Icebreaker and Daydream. Originally published: 03 October 2023 Author: Hannah Grace Followed by: Icebreaker Genres: Contemporary, Fiction, Romance Pages: 400 pages Series: Maple Hills #2 Over view: Wildfire by Hannah Grace is the second novel in the Maple Hills college hockey romance series. This instalment follows Russ, the shy goalie who takes a job at a summer camp to escape his messy home life over the summer. At a party, Russ hooks up with Aurora, an extroverted English major, but is disappointed when she leaves quickly. However, Russ quickly runs into Aurora again at the summer camp, where is also a counsellor to avoid her family drama over the summer. Inferno is a 2013 mystery thriller novel by American author Dan Brown and the fourth book in his Robert Langdon series, following Angels & Demons, The Da Vinci Code and The Lost Symbol. Originally published: 14 May 2013 Author: Dan Brown Followed by: Origin Genres: Thriller, Mystery, Suspense, Detective fiction, Adventure fiction, Conspiracy fiction Pages: 642 pages Series: Robert Langdon #4 Over View: Inferno is a 2013 heart-stopping mystery thriller by American author Dan Brown, taking readers on a journey through Florence, Venice, and Istanbul. Dan Brown's fourth Robert Langdon book, Inferno, throws the clever professor into another complex mystery with global consequences. Professor Robert Langdon faces a scientist bent on destruction: a scientist who finds inspiration in Dante Alighieri's Inferno. Book - People On Our Roof Author - Shefali Tripathi Mehta @niyogibooks Genre - Fiction ( theme of loss and trauma in the context of mental illness) For our protagonist Naina growing up was not easy. Abandoned by her father and living with a Schizophrenic mother and autistic sister, things were not easy for Naina. As a child Naina had hated her sister and wanted another mother. But growing up,with an absent father, Naina had worked fingers to the bone to support herself and her family alongside running the house. Others called her home Pagalkhana. They would say who would marry Naina. but what troubled her most was the past - the reason of her father's disappearance. She was badly looking for a closure. #bookreview Writing on mental illness is never easy but Shefali has done a commendable job. She highlights about mental illness in a thoughtful manner - what it is like to live with mentally unwell people, the challenges, society's behaviour to the same. Without actually mentioning she communicates how the society fails those who are mentally ill. Through Naina's story the book explores themes of loss, trauma, caregiver fatigue, parental neglect. Emotional complexities in the book is written with good care. The author's narration and writing feels so raw which makes the story feel like a hybrid of fiction and memoir. The story also highlights that at times we judge others blindly without actually knowing them which is very wrong on our part. All in all it was a great read. There is so much to learn from Naina the one who never gave up and emerged victorious on her own. Book Review: Show Your Work by Austin Kleon Goodreads Rating: 4.12/5 My Rating: ⭐⭐⭐⭐ Show Your Work!" by Austin Kleon is a guide for anyone and everyone aiming to share their creativity and work process with the world. In this book the author tells us that the key to getting discovered and appreciated isn't just about producing excellent work but also about sharing the process behind it. He encourages readers to become "findable" by showing their work in progress, sharing their influences, and engaging with a community. The book is structured around ten simple principles to help creatives build an audience, share their work effectively, and connect with others. He urges readers to harness the power of the internet as a tool for showing the messy, trial-and-error process of creation. Through sharing, we learn, attract opportunities, and connect with others who can relate to our struggles and triumphs. The book revolves around the enigmatic Larry Darrell, a young American who returns from World War I deeply affected by the horrors he witnessed. Larry's search for meaning leads him to renounce materialism and embark on a spiritual journey which takes him from the bustling streets of Chicago to the serene ashrams of India. All while leaving his relationships behind, which he always thought were needed for survival. Larry seeks answers to life's most profound questions, and in doing so, he captures the essence of a post-war generation grappling with disillusionment and a thirst for a deeper understanding of existence.
